Item Description

Classic green Cuprian Adamite crystals from the historic Ojuela mine in Mexico. The color is not common for Adamite from any locality, and the form, sharpness and luster makes this piece very desirable. Several well-formed, lustrous, "wedge"-shaped, pseudo-octahedral crystals can be seen sprinkled on the Limonite matrix. The crystals are admittedly small (about 3 mm), but they looks beautiful up close. The piece is in excellent condition overall. The color is what matters here. This mine is well known for its amazingly intense colors of Adamite, and this small cabinet is certainly a great example of said material.
